def add_from_file(self, *filepaths, **kwargs):
"""
Add data to the scene by loading them from a file. Should handle .obj, .vtk and .nii files.
:param filepaths: path to the file. Can pass as many arguments as needed
:param **kwargs:
"""
actors = []
for filepath in filepaths:
actor = load_mesh_from_file(filepath, **kwargs)
actor.name = Path(filepath).name
self.actors.append(actor)
actors.append(actor)
return return_list_smart(actors)

def add_actor(self, *actors, store=None):
"""
Add a vtk actor to the scene
:param actor:
:param store: a list to store added actors
"""
for actor in actors:
if store is None:
self.actors.append(actor)
else:
store.append(actor)
return return_list_smart(actors)
